When I execute the code below, I cannot press the OK button.
Do you have the same symptoms?iPhone X(iOS12.4.1)
Pythonista 3 v.3.2(320000)import ui main = ui.ScrollView(frame=(0, 0, 375, 812)) main.content_size = (375, 812) wv = ui.WebView(frame=(0, 0,*main.content_size)) wv.load_url('https://www.google.co.jp/') main.add_subview(wv) main.present('fullscreen') wv.evaluate_javascript('alert("123");')

@tomomo this works on iPhone 5s iOS 12.4.3
Perhaps, you did not wait for the web page to be loaded before doing your alertimport ui main = ui.ScrollView(frame=(0, 0, 375, 812)) main.content_size = (375, 812) wv = ui.WebView(frame=(0, 0,*main.content_size)) wv.load_url('https://www.google.co.jp/') main.add_subview(wv) main.present('fullscreen') def x(): wv.evaluate_javascript('alert("123");') ui.delay(x,1)
-
@cvp I will try it.
-
@tomomo and, normally, you should use delegate of WebView
import ui class MyWebViewDelegate (object): def webview_did_finish_load(self, webview): wv.evaluate_javascript('alert("123");') main = ui.ScrollView(frame=(0, 0, 375, 812)) main.content_size = (375, 812) wv = ui.WebView(frame=(0, 0,*main.content_size)) wv.delegate = MyWebViewDelegate() main.add_subview(wv) main.present('fullscreen') wv.load_url('https://www.google.co.jp/')
